WebMar 30, 2024 · Saussure on Signs "[Swiss linguist Ferdinand de] Saussure argued that the meaning of a sign is arbitrary and variable. . . . In Saussure's terms, any sign consists of a signifier (the sound a word makes, its physical shape on the page) and a signified (the word's content). This head-dress comes from the Ifugao people in Luzon, northern Philippines. Its woven frame is decorated with feathers and seated on top is a wooden figure - the rice god Bul-ul. Dress • Male clothing - consisted of the upper and lower parts. The upper part was a jacket with short sleeves called “kangan” while the lower part was a strip of cloth wrapped around the waist and in between the legs called “bahag”.
